﻿@charset "utf-8";
/* CSS Document */

body{ background:#ffffff; width:1004px; text-align:center!important;margin:0px auto; }
td ,div{ text-align:left; font-size:12px; font-family:Arial}
.bodywidth{ width:950px;}
img {border:0;}
.logotitle{ vertical-align:top; color:#A1D4FE; font-size:16px;}
#nav{ color:#4E4E4E; font-weight:bold;}

.menuTDfont{  color:#4E4E4E;  font-family:Arial, Helvetica, sans-serif; font-size:13px; text-align:center; padding-left:10px; padding-right:10px;}
.menuTDfont a{ color:#4E4E4E;  font-family:Arial, Helvetica, sans-serif; font-size:13px; text-decoration:none}
.menuTDfont a:hover{ color:#4E4E4E;  font-family:Arial, Helvetica, sans-serif; font-size:13px; text-decoration:underline;}

/*.menuTDfont a:hover{ text-decoration:underline}*/


.menuhome{ background:url(images/menu_03.jpg) no-repeat 0px 0px ; display:block; width:66px; height:26px; padding-top:5px; text-align:center;  color:#FFFFFF; text-decoration:underline}
.menuhome:hover{ background:url(images/menu_03.jpg) no-repeat ; display:block; width:66px; height:26px; padding-top:5px;color:#FFFFFF!important;cursor:hand;background-position: 0PX -31PX;}
.menuhomehover{ background:url(images/menu_03.jpg) no-repeat; display:block; width:66px; height:26px; padding-top:5px; color:#FFFFFF!important; text-decoration:underline;background-position: 0PX -31PX;}
.menuhome span{width:66px; text-align:center!important; display:block;}
.menuhomehover span{width:66px; text-align:center!important; display:block;}
.menuhomehover:hover{color:#FFFFFF;cursor:hand;}




.menuDownload{ background:url(images/menu_04.jpg) no-repeat; display:block; width:96px; height:26px; padding-top:5px; color:#FFFFFF; text-decoration:none}
.menuDownload:hover{ background:url(images/menu_04.jpg) no-repeat; display:block; width:96px; height:26px; padding-top:5px;color:#FFFFFF!important;cursor:hand;background-position: 0PX -31PX;}
.menuDownloadhover{ background:url(images/menu_04.jpg) no-repeat; display:block; width:96px; height:26px; padding-top:5px; color:#FFFFFF!important; text-decoration:underline;background-position: 0PX -31PX;}
.menuDownload span{width:96px; text-align:center!important; display:block;}
.menuDownloadhover span{width:96px; text-align:center!important; display:block;}
.menuDownloadhover:hover{color:#FFFFFF!important; cursor:hand;}


.menuProduct{ background:url(images/menu_05.jpg) no-repeat; display:block; width:85px; height:26px; padding-top:5px; color:#FFFFFF; text-decoration:none}
.menuProduct:hover{ background:url(images/menu_05.jpg) no-repeat; display:block; width:85px; height:26px; padding-top:5px;color:#FFFFFF!important;cursor:hand;background-position: 0PX -31PX;}
.menuProducthover{ background:url(images/menu_05.jpg) no-repeat; display:block; width:85px; height:26px; padding-top:5px; color:#FFFFFF!important; text-decoration:underline;background-position: 0PX -31PX;}
.menuProduct span{width:85px; text-align:center!important; display:block;}
.menuProducthover span{width:85px; text-align:center!important; display:block;}
.menuProducthover:hover{color:#FFFFFF!important;cursor:hand;}


.menuAbout{ background:url(images/menu_08.jpg) no-repeat; display:block; width:79px; height:26px; padding-top:5px; color:#FFFFFF; text-decoration:none}
.menuAbout:hover{background:url(images/menu_08.jpg) no-repeat; display:block; width:79px; height:26px; padding-top:5px; color:#FFFFFF!important;cursor:hand;background-position: 0PX -31PX;}
.menuAbouthover{ background:url(images/menu_08.jpg) no-repeat; display:block; width:79px; height:26px; padding-top:5px; color:#FFFFFF!important; text-decoration:underline;background-position: 0PX -31PX;}
.menuAbout span{width:79px; text-align:center!important; display:block;}
.menuAbouthover span{width:79px; text-align:center!important; display:block;}
.menuAbouthover:hover{color:#ffffff!important;cursor:hand;}


.menuEmail{ background:url(images/menu_08.jpg) no-repeat; display:block; width:79px; height:26px; padding-top:5px; color:#FFFFFF; text-decoration:none}
.menuEmail:hover{ background:url(images/menu_08.jpg) no-repeat; display:block; width:79px; height:26px; padding-top:5px;color:#FFFFFF!important;cursor:hand;background-position: 0PX -31PX;}
.menuEmailhover{ background:url(images/menu_08.jpg) no-repeat; display:block; width:79px; height:26px; padding-top:5px; color:#FFFFFF; text-decoration:underline;background-position: 0PX -31PX;}
.menuEmail span{width:79px; text-align:center!important; display:block;}
.menuEmailhover span{width:79px; text-align:center!important; display:block;}
.menuEmailhover:hover{color:#4E4E4E!important;cursor:hand;}


.menublog{ background:url(images/menu_08.jpg) no-repeat; display:block; width:79px; height:26px; padding-top:5px; color:#FFFFFF; text-decoration:none}
.menublog:hover{ background:url(images/menu_08.jpg) no-repeat; display:block; width:79px; height:26px; padding-top:5px;color:#FFFFFF!important;cursor:hand;background-position: 0PX -31PX;}
.menubloghover{ background:url(images/menu_08.jpg) no-repeat; display:block; width:79px; height:26px; padding-top:5px; color:#FFFFFF; text-decoration:underline;background-position: 0PX -31PX;}
.menublog span{width:79px; text-align:center!important; display:block;}
.menubloghover span{width:79px; text-align:center!important; display:block;}
.menubloghover:hover{color:#4E4E4E!important;cursor:hand;}







.menuTD{}
#topnav{ background:url(images/QiQisoft_06.jpg) repeat-x top; height:35px; color:#FFFFFF;}
#topnav td{ vertical-align:middle; padding-left:20px;}
#topnav a{ color:#FFFFFF; text-decoration:none}
#topnav a:hover{ color:#FFFFFF; text-decoration:underline;}

#topnavWEI{ background:url(images/QiQisoft_08.jpg) repeat-x top; height:5px; color:#FFFFFF;}
.topnavWEI{  height:30px; color:#FFFFFF; vertical-align:top; padding-top:5px; text-align:center;}


.PRODUCT TD{ border-bottom:1px solid #000000}
h5{ font-size:16px; color:#000000;  height:20px; margin:0px; padding:0} 
h7{ font-size:14px; color:#000000;  height:20px; margin:0px; padding:0; font-weight:bold;} 
h11{ font-size:18px}
.view{ line-height:20px; color:#666666}
.view strong{ font-size:14px; color:#000000}

.viewshow{ color:#000000; font-size:12px; line-height:20px; padding:22px; padding-top:0px;}

#topbannerSMAIL{ background:url(images/QiQisoft_11.jpg) repeat-x top; height:12px; color:#FFFFFF;}


#topCONTACT{ background:#626161; height:121PX; color:#FFFFFF}
#topCONTACT  td{ vertical-align:top}

.topcontact1{ width:191px; padding-top:15px;}
.topcontact2{ padding-top:15px;}
.topcontactge{ width:30px; text-align:center;}
#topCONTACT span{ color:#FF6600}
#maingetop{ color:#FFFFFF; height:30px;}


#main { padding-left:10px;padding-right:10px; vertical-align:top;}

#productFENGE{ }
.productFENGE{ border-right:1px #CCCCCC dashed; border-bottom:1px #CCCCCC dashed; width:33%; padding:10px 10px 15px 10px;}
.productFENGE2{ border-right:1px #CCCCCC dashed;  width:33%; padding:10px 10px 15px 10px;}
.productFENGE1{   border-bottom:1px #CCCCCC dashed; width:33%; padding:10px 10px 15px 10px;}
.productFENGE3{   width:33%; padding:10px 10px 15px 10px;}


.Ptubiao{ width:45px; text-align:left; vertical-align:top;}
.Pfont{  text-decoration:none; text-align:left; vertical-align:top; line-height:18px; color:#343434}
#topbanner{ background:url(images/registryrid_13.jpg) no-repeat top; height:319px;}
#topSTEP{ background:url(images/registryrid_15.jpg) no-repeat top; height:104px;}

#bottom{ border-top:5px #000000 solid; margin-top:10px;}
#bottom td{ text-align:center!important; color:#000000; height:50px; font-family:Arial, Helvetica, sans-serif; font-size:12px}
#bottom td a{ color:#000000!important; text-decoration:none}






.topBANNER1{ vertical-align:top!important; width:407px; }
.topBANNER1 div{  margin-left:31px; margin-top:28px;}
.topBANNER2{ vertical-align:top; text-align:left!important; width:380px;}
.topBANNER2 div{  margin:0; color:#FFFFFF; font-size:12px; font-family:Arial, Helvetica, sans-serif; display:block; }
.topBANNER2 div li{ list-style:none; margin:0; padding:0 ; height:22px;  font-family:Arial; font-size:12px; color:#FFFFFF}
.topBANNER2 .topBANNER2font td{ color:#FFFFFF; font-size:12px; height:22px; }
.topBANNER2 .topBANNER2font { margin-top:15px;}

.topBANNER2font
.topBANNER3{ width:189px;vertical-align:top; }
.topBANNER3 div{  margin-left:20px; margin-top:50px; font-size:50px; font-weight:bold; color:#FFFFFF}


#tableheight{ background:#FFFFFF; height:48px;}
#bodyMAIN{ background:#FFFFFF; padding-bottom:20px;}
.bodymainFONTdefault{ padding-left:18PX; font-size:12px;line-height:16px; color:#282828}
.bodyMAINleft h1{ font-size:20px; font-weight:bold; color:#073D70; margin-bottom:16px; margin-top:20px; margin-left:5px;}
.jiange{ background:url(images/jiange.jpg) no-repeat left ; height:28px; margin-top:15px;margin-bottom:15px; width:100%; clear:both;  }

#litext1{ float:left; width:360px; font-size:12px}
#litext1 li{ width:300px; font-size:12px; height:20px;}
#litext2{ float:right; width:330px;font-size:12px}
#litext2 li{ width:300px; font-size:12px; height:20px;}





.bodyMAINleft{ width:729px;  padding-right:15px; border-right:1px dashed #5E97CE;vertical-align:top}

.bodyMAINright{ padding-left:18px; padding-right:18px; vertical-align:top}

h3{ text-align:center; font-size:14px; margin:0}

.bodymainFONTright{ padding-left:5PX; padding-right:5px; font-size:12px;line-height:16px; color:#6B6B6B}

.bodymainRIGHtitle{ background:#5E97CE; color:#FFFFFF; font-size:16px; font-weight:bold; height:25px; margin-top:15px ; margin-bottom:15px; padding-top:10px;}

.texta
	{
	color:#000;
	font-family:verdana;
	font-size:11px;		
	line-height: 16px;			
	font-weight : normal;
	text-align:justify;	
	}
	
.name
{ 
font-family: Verdana, Arial, sans-serif; 
font-size: 11px; 
color: #f28313; 
text-align: right; 
margin-top:7px; 
margin-bottom:17px; 
}
.quote_left 
{ 
font-family: Arial, sans-serif; 
font-size: 22px; 
font-weight: bold; 
color: #f28313; 
}
.highlight 
{ 
font-family: Verdana, Arial, sans-serif; 
font-size: 14px;
line-height:19px; 
font-weight: bold; 
}
.quote_right 
{ 
font-family: Arial, sans-serif; 
font-size: 14px; 
font-weight: bold; 
color: #f28313; 
}
h2{ font-size:16px; font-weight:bold; color:#333333; margin-bottom:16px; margin-top:20px; margin-left:5px; background:url(images/H1SPAN.jpg) no-repeat; padding-left:20px; display:block;}


h1{ font-size:24px; font-weight:bold; color:#000000; margin-bottom:16px; margin-top:20px; margin-left:5px;}

.bodymainFONT{ margin-left:20px;font-family:Arial, Helvetica, sans-serif; font-size:15px ; color:#3E3E3E;  line-height:22px; padding-right:23PX;}
.bodymainFONT a{ color:#333333; text-decoration:none}
.bodymainFONT a:hover{  text-decoration:underline}


.FEATURES TD{ text-align:center;}
.screenshots  TD{ text-align:center; padding-bottom:15px; border-bottom:1px dashed #999999 ; padding-top:15px;}


.topSTEPfont{ color:#FFFFFF!important}
.topSTEPfont TD{ vertical-align:top;color:#FFFFFF!important}
.topSTEPfont1{ width:339PX; vertical-align:top;font-size:12px!important ; color:#F4F4F4!important;line-height:16PX;  }
.topSTEPfont1 .span1{ display:block;MARGIN-left:18PX; MARGIN-right:20PX;MARGIN-top:35PX; font-size:12px!important ; color:#ffffff!important;line-height:16PX;  }
.topSTEPfont2{ width:352PX; vertical-align:top; }
.topSTEPfont2 .span2{display:block;MARGIN-left:34PX; MARGIN-right:20PX;MARGIN-top:35PX; font-size:12px!important ; color:#F4F4F4!important;line-height:16PX;  }

.topSTEPfont3{ width:285PX; vertical-align:top; }
.topSTEPfont3 .span3{display:block;MARGIN-left:34PX; MARGIN-right:20PX;MARGIN-top:35PX; font-size:12px!important ; color:#F4F4F4!important; line-height:16PX; }







.productname{ padding:5px 10px 5px 15px; line-height:18px; }
.productname a{ color:#333333; text-decoration:none}
.productname a:hover{ color:#000000; text-decoration:underline;}


.productVersion{ font-size:14px ; text-align:center;}
.productSize{ font-size:14px ; text-align:center;}
.productDownload{ font-size:14px ; text-align:center;}
.productstrong{ font-size:14px; line-height:20px;}
.productimg{ text-align:center; vertical-align:middle; padding:20px;  border-bottom:1px #CCCCCC dashed!important; color:#6D6D6D;font-size:12px}
.productMAIN{ text-align:left; padding:10PX 15PX 10PX 15PX;  border-bottom:1px #CCCCCC dashed!important;color:#6D6D6D; font-size:12px!important; font-family:Arial, Helvetica, sans-serif}

.productstrong a{ color:#000000; text-decoration:underline}
.productstrong a:hover{ color:#000000; text-decoration:none;}

.buy{ color:#000000; text-decoration:none}

.buy:hover{ color:#FF0000; text-decoration:underline}

.download{ color:#000000; text-decoration:none}

.download:hover{ color:#FF0000; text-decoration:underline}

.titleFONT{
	font-size:14px;
	color:#000000;
	background:url(images/titlebg.jpg) repeat-x;
	padding-top:5px;
	text-decoration: none;
}
.titleBFONT{ font-size:14px; color:#000000; background:url(images/titlebBG.jpg) repeat-x; }
#title1MAIN{background:url(images/mainbg.jpg) repeat-y; padding:20px; padding-top:0;}

.fonttitleBG{
	font-size:14px;
	color:#ffffff;
	background:url(images/fonttitleBG.jpg) repeat-x;
	padding-left:10px;
	text-decoration: none;
}
#productbannerSMAIL{ height:9px;}

.proJIESHAOleft{ padding-right: 15px; padding-bottom:10px;padding-top:20PX; border-bottom:#D0D0D0 dashed 1px; border-right:#D0D0D0 dashed 1px; width:450px;}
.proJIESHAOright{ padding-left: 15px; padding-bottom:10px;padding-top:20PX; border-bottom:#D0D0D0 dashed 1px; width:450px;}

.PRODUCTimgIMG{ text-align:center; }

.PRODUCTimg{ width:220px;}

.PRODUCTFONTSPAN{ padding-left:5PX;}
.PRODUCTFONTSPAN span{ display:block; background:url(images/spanbg.jpg) no-repeat left top; padding-left:15px;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#424242; line-height:18px;}

.fonttitle{ margin-bottom:10px;}

#bottomSHUOMING{ margin-top:3PX;}

#title1MAIN2{ padding:10px;background:url(images/mainbg.jpg) repeat-y;}

.PRODUCTgongtong{ background:url(images/productbg.jpg) repeat-y; padding-left:15px; padding-right:15px;}

.bottomSHUOMINGfont{ padding:10px; line-height:18px;}
.productFONTZ{ padding-left:10PX; padding-right:15PX; font-size:12px; line-height:18PX; font-weight:normal;}
.productFONTZ SPAN{ display:block; background:url(images/H1SPAN.jpg) no-repeat left top; padding-left:25px;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#424242; line-height:18px; font-weight:bold;}

.PRODUCT1pro{ margin-top:15px; border-top:1px #CCCCCC dashed;}

.PRODUCT1proBORDER{ margin-top:8PX;}

.fonttitle2{
	width:300px;
	text-decoration: none;
}

.PRODUCT1FONTSPAN{ line-height:20PX; color:#424242; padding-top:10px; padding-left:5px; padding-right:15px;}
.fonttitleBG2{
	font-size:14px;
	color:#000000;
	background:url(images/fonttitleBG.jpg) repeat-x;
	padding-left:10px;
	text-decoration: none;
}
.fonttitle11{
	font-size:14px;
	color:#000000;
	padding-left:10px;
	text-decoration: none;
}
.buydown{ background:url(images/buybg.jpg) repeat-x!important;}
